  5. We chose this cruise because we go away every year during jersey week as our son is off from school and its a 30 min drive from home;

     

    Embarkation- The line of cars took over an hour as we arrived at 11am and did not check in till 12, once parked it was easy and a 15 min process.

     

    Once on the ship waited on line for 40 min to eat lunch which became a running theme for the week. No sail away party, was a nice dice so not sure why.

     

    Dining- We had reservations for my time dining every day, even with a set time, there was a long line every night, took 30 mins to get seated after our reservation then at least 90-120 mins to eat, an exhausting process. The food was very good, all steaks were cooked to order, service varied some spotty to very good. Breakfast in Windjammer was below par other than the donuts which was best in any of our 30 cruises. Did not really have lunch as was not hungry and could not deal with the craziness of the lines. Hot dog truck was awful and generic.

     

    Entertainment- What we liked- the band Wanted-so much fun, We will Rock you-story is silly but cast sound the Queen songs well, Abba show was corny but fun. Comedians were fine, not great , not awful. House band was ok All 4 One. I fly while great was worth doing but is only 1 minute. What we did not like-while all the bells and whistles sounds great- the lines to do anything fun was just brutal and not making it worth it for us nor our teen. Indoor pool and Solarium were packed on the cold day, Walked out at Spectra after 10 mins- beyond awful. Did not see The Gift.

     

    Staff-Cruise Director and staff were OK, nothing special but not bad. Nothing memorable to be honest.

     

    Teen Club- Our son made friends which was good but the activities were awful, he called it one of the worst of his 25 cruises.

     

    Main Pool- we had 2 nice days, very hard to find seats, only 1 activity by the pool, band was bland.

     

    Drink package- I had it and my wife did not, took patience to get drinks and they were understaffed but I did not attentive waiters while sitting on the 2nd deck so that was a positive, Bionic bar was cute.

     

    :Ports- Florida- We rented a car, went to Epcot on our own and had a great time. Coca Cay- Awesome warm day, went to the end of island away from everyone who get off and sit at a very crowded beach, floating bar so much fun even if drinks were limited. Fantastic day. Nassau- took a taxi to Melia, solid day

     

    Cabin- Had a Handicap room, so large and great, room steward was invisible but fine.

     

    Ship- Crazy crowded, lines for everything you can think of, not sure we would ever go on this ship again.

     

    Over all good cruise but we will remember the norovirus, long lines more than anything else other than Wanted and We will Rock you. We were able to use imessage for free when connected to the wifi . Also had a free apps work as well and we did not pay for anything

     

     

    Debarkation- We walked off our selves, ate breakfast at 8, then it took about an hour to walk off and get through customs.
